The holiday park is situated on a beautiful plot of no less than 7 hectares. The park is surrounded by a large golf course where you can play golf in peace and quiet. If you only want to watch, you can do so from your own terrace or balcony. There is also a heated indoor and outdoor swimming pool. The outdoor pool is only open from May to September. During your stay, you also have access to the sauna in the indoor pool and several sports fields, such as a volleyball court. But the best thing about the location of this holiday park is of course its location so close to the coast. The large beach of Omaha Beach is only 9 km away from the holiday park.

Lively Port-en-Bessin-Huppain is located by the sea and has a beautiful small harbour. You can enjoy dinner here and then take a long evening stroll along the quay. The view here is magnificent! The region and location near the D-day beaches is known for its rich history during World War II. For example, visit the American cemetery in Colleville-sur-Mer (9km) or visit the Memorial Museum in Arromanches (14km). The casemates in Lonques-sur-Mer (9km) are also not to be missed.
